Implement the so-called "first failure data capture" (FFDC) for the symbios PCI error recovery. After a PCI error event is reported, the driver requests that MMIO be enabled. Once enabled, it then reads and dumps assorted status registers, and concludes by requesting the usual reset sequence. (includes a whitespace fix for bad indentation).
